Forex Scam Detection: Expert Tips & Warnings
Navigating the forex market can be challenging, and unfortunately, scams are prevalent. Experts advise carefully scrutinizing any platform offering guaranteed profits, as this is a significant flag. Be wary of pushy sales tactics and promises of easy riches. Regularly verify the credentials of the broker with relevant bodies like the FCA, ASIC, or CySEC. Moreover, research the organization's history and review client testimonials on independent review sites. Ultimately, trust your gut feeling – if something seems incredible to be true, it most likely is.
Broker Review Scam : Distinguishing Reality from Fabrication
The online world is brimming with resources offering investment reviews, but it's crucial to identify that not all are authentic . Several appear trustworthy on the surface, but are, in reality, carefully constructed scams designed to sway potential clients . These unethical operations often utilize fake testimonials, exaggerated ratings, and sponsored content to paint a rosy picture of a particular broker. Therefore , it's need to be extremely wary and diligently investigate any review prior to trusting its assertions . Look for independent sources, confirm the author's background, and be conscious of any suspicious elements that might point to a artificial review.
Don't Get Fooled: Investment Scam Prevention Guide
Protecting your money requires vigilance in the modern investment landscape. Scams are increasingly clever, targeting individuals of all ages and experience backgrounds . This guide offers key steps to avoid becoming a target of investment scams . Be wary of offers of substantial returns with little risk; legitimate investments typically involve a degree of danger . Carefully research any opportunity, verifying the qualifications of the firm and its personnel. Don’t be pressured into making fast decisions, and never send payments to someone you haven't independently checked. Remember, if it sounds too fantastic to be true, it probably is.
- Verify the licensing of investment professionals .
- Be suspicious of surprise investment proposals .
- Know the costs associated with any scheme.
- Notify any doubtful activity to the appropriate regulators .
